A desktop disk cleanup application is software designed to help users clean up their hard drives or storage devices. These apps scan a user’s system for unnecessary files, temporary data, browser cache, and other clutter, then provide options to delete or compress these files. The ultimate goal is to free up valuable storage space and improve the overall performance of the computer.

Disk cleanup applications can be broadly categorized into three types. Let’s explore each one.
Manual cleanup tools offer users a more hands-on approach. These tools require users to scan their systems and manually select files for deletion. They provide transparency and control over the cleaning process, making them ideal for users who want to ensure they don’t delete anything crucial by mistake.
Automatic disk cleanup tools do the heavy lifting for users by scanning the system, identifying unnecessary files, and automatically cleaning them. These tools are ideal for users who want a hands-off approach and rely on the software to maintain their system health without intervention.
Cloud-based cleanup solutions are a newer category of disk cleanup tools. These tools offer users the ability to clean up their local storage by leveraging cloud-based resources. While this method can save space on the device itself, it may also involve syncing data to external servers.

The best disk cleanup application for Windows depends on your specific needs. Popular options include CCleaner, Disk Cleanup Tool (built into Windows), and Glary Utilities. Each offers various features ranging from simple file cleanup to more advanced system optimization.
Yes, disk cleanup tools are generally safe to use, but it’s essential to choose a reliable and trusted application. Some tools may offer features like file recovery or automatic cleaning, but they should never delete critical system files.
It’s recommended to clean your disk at least once a month. However, if you notice that your system is slowing down or running out of storage, you may want to run a cleanup more frequently.
Yes, regularly cleaning your disk can improve your computer’s performance. By removing unnecessary files, freeing up space, and reducing clutter, your system will run faster and more efficiently.
Some disk cleanup applications offer file recovery options, but this depends on the specific software. Always check the app’s features before using it for file recovery.
